The Potential of Golden Promise Gold Project

 

Great Atlantic Resources (TSXV:GR; FRA:PH01) is actively exploring for some of the world’s most desirable commodities:  gold, antimony and tungsten. 

 

And they’re focusing on Atlantic Canada, where there is strong potential to discover and advance world class economic deposits.

 

In fact, one of Great Atlantic’s top three key assets is the 100% owned Golden Promise Gold Project.

 

Located in Newfoundland on the Central Newfoundland Gold Belt, Golden Promise is the company’s most advanced, highest priority and largest property at 16,500 hectares.

 

The Golden Promise Gold Project hosts multiple gold bearing quartz veins and is located within a region of recent significant gold discoveries. 

 

The most notable of these is Marathon Gold Corporation’s (TSXV: MOZ) flagship Valentine Gold Project.  Valentine Lake boasts a 4.2 million gold ounce resource and is being advanced towards development.

 

Several producing mines are proof of Newfoundland and Labrador’s geological potential. These include Duck Pond (Teck), Long Harbour (Vale), Voisey’s Bay (Vale), Ming Mine (Rambler), Tata Steel Minerals, Iron Ore Company of Canada, and Labrador Iron Mines Ltd.

 

Diligent Work Continues to Add Value

 

For Golden Promise Gold Project, it all started back in 2002 when gold bearing quartz boulders were first reported on the property.

 

Since then multiple exploration programs have been completed, including some 24,500 meters of diamond drilling, an historic (2008) and recent (2018) mineral resource estimates, and an historic (2010) bulk sample.  That bulk sample reported solid results:  approximately 2200 tonnes with a reported 5.59 g/t head grade.

 

 

In late 2018, Great Atlantic reported a National Instrument 43-101 mineral resource estimate for the Jaclyn Main Zone (JMZ) by Mr. Greg Z. Mosher (M.Sc. App., P.Geo.) and Mr. Larry Pilgrim (B.Sc., P.Geo.).  That report stated a total inferred mineral resource of 357,500 tonnes at 10.4 g/t gold (uncapped) at a 1.1 g/t gold cutoff for the JMZ (119,900 oz. gold (uncapped).

 

 

A 1000-meter diamond drill program was initiated last October to further test the Jaclyn Zone, which hosts multiple gold-bearing quartz vein systems. The Jaclyn Zone is the most advanced zone on Golden Promise Gold Project. The 2019 drilling program focused on a section of the JMZ.

 

In early December Great Atlantic announced completion of the 10-hole drill program, totaling 1063 meters, and that visible gold was intersected within quartz veins in four holes. Assays are pending for drill core samples.

 

 

Nine holes tested the west half of the JMZ within the conceptual open pit-constrained area. One hole tested the deeper central part of the JMZ. Nine holes intersected quartz veins with plus / minus sulfide mineralization. The remaining hole was stopped prematurely before reaching the target depth.

 

The Jaclyn zone is found within the northern region of the Golden Promise Gold Project, and has thus far revealed five gold bearing quartz vein systems: being the JMZ, Jaclyn North Zone, Jaclyn West Zone, Jaclyn South Zone and Jaclyn East Zone.  Assays are currently pending from the 2019 diamond drilling program at the Jaclyn Main Zone.

Golden Promise Gold Project occurs in the same tectonostratigraphic tectonic zone as the Valentine Gold Project of Marathon Gold Corp. (TSXV: MOZ) The Valentine Gold Project is located approximately 45 kilometers southwest of Golden Promise Gold Project. Both projects occur within the Exploits Subzone of the Newfoundland Dunnage Zone, both on the southeast side of the Red Indian Line, a major (Appalachian-scale) collisional boundary, and suture zone. Within the Exploits Subzone, the Golden Promise Gold Project lies along the north-northwestern fringe of the Victoria Lake Supergroup (VLSG), a volcano-sedimentary terrane.
